Babe Ruth H & B bat
 
Today I purchased a 20s babe ruth H&B bat in very good condition however it has minor surface scratches and is not clean. I would like to keep its collectible value but use a product that will remove dirt and will bring out the rich wood color and polish for purposes of displaying. I have been buying other vintage bats but have been careful not to do the wrong thing but am ready to prepare them for display as well. Would love any expertise on products I can safely use.

Honus2 02-11-2015 09:53 PM

Thanks all. I followed your advice and used formbys lemon oil after using a light application of murphys oil soap to remove dirt. I liked the result. Still learning however - have several vintage bats but have been reluctant to clean knowing how delicate cleaning any vintage / antique example can be. Still refraining from using steel wool not saying it doesn't work. I just can't undo what I have already done :)
